Synthesis of symmetrical dimeric N,N′-linked peptides on solid support by olefin metathesis

2000 
Abstract A method has been developed for the synthesis of dimeric ligands of biological relevance on solid support using olefin metathesis as a key step. With the ruthenium catalyst used, the size of the peptide fragment did not influence the reaction. If the double bond involved was separated by at least ∼2 methylene groups from an amide group, products of good purity could be recovered.
